CASIX: Global monthly carbon primary production estimates

CASIX, the Centre for observation of Air-Sea Interactions & fluXes, is a NERC Centre of Excellence in Earth Observation. The scientific focus was on advancing the science of air-sea interactions and reducing the errors in the prediction of climate change. The primary goal was to quantify accurately the global air-sea fluxes of carbon dioxide (CO2). CASIX accelerated the exploitation of new Earth Observation satellite data to further the understanding of marine biogeochemistry in the Earth System. CASIX links NERC Centres, university groups and the Met Office to model ocean circulation and the ocean carbon cycle.



This dataset contains global monthly primary production estimates derived using the Smyth et al 2005 model from SeaWiFS data.
